Key responsibilities
Asset Liability Management
- Framing and implementing effective ALM strategy
- Ensure regular monitoring and establishing process and governance around duration gap, cash flow gap; assess exposure to interest rate risk, reinvestment risks and liquidity risks.
- Engage with Finance/Investment teams to align asset strategies with liability profiles
- Taking care of all Shareholder and Regulatory reporting requirements, queries etc
- Support Investment team on preliminary SAA and Final SAA submissions to GHO
- Support in ad hoc reports as and when required by GARO/GHO
IND AS implementation and RBC framework
- Laying down IND AS reporting framework for the company
- Ensuring fulfillment of all regulatory requirement
- Liaise closely with Finance team for perfoma preparation
- Closer of all audit requirement
- Reconciliation of numbers with IGGAP reports and Group submissions
- In parallel setting up RBC process basis QIS studies
- Projections of RBC with IND AS to assess the future capital and solvency position
- Setting up internal model and framework for optimizing capital under RBC regime
Other area of work and support includes, but not limited to –
- Experience studies – claim and mortality
- Identify emerging trends and provide actuarial insights to relevant stakeholders for assumption setting and pricing
- Collaborate with Underwriting and Claims team to investigate deviations or shifts in claims experience.
- Prophet Modelling - Develop and enhance actuarial models used for various reporting such as statutory, IFRS17, SII, IND AS, RBC etc.
- Overseeing modelling work and ensuring model governance and control frameworks, maintaining documentation in line with internal SOPs and audit
